function display_po_receive_items()
{
global $table_style;
+
+ div_start('grn_items');
start_table("colspan=7 $table_style width=90%");
$th = array(_("Item Code"), _("Description"), _("Ordered"), _("Units"), _("Received"),
_("Outstanding"), _("This Delivery"), _("Price"), _("Total"));
qty_cell($qty_outstanding, false, $dec);
if ($qty_outstanding > 0)
- qty_cells(null, $ln_itm->line_no, qty_format($ln_itm->receive_qty, $ln_itm->stock_id, $dec), "align=right", null, $dec);
+ qty_cells(null, $ln_itm->line_no, number_format2($ln_itm->receive_qty, $dec), "align=right", null, $dec);
else
- qty_cells(null, $ln_itm->line_no, qty_format($ln_itm->receive_qty, $ln_itm->stock_id, $dec), "align=right",
+ qty_cells(null, $ln_itm->line_no, number_format2($ln_itm->receive_qty, $dec), "align=right",
"disabled", $dec);
amount_cell($ln_itm->price);
label_row(_("Total value of items received"), $display_total, "colspan=8 align=right",
"nowrap align=right");
end_table();
+ div_end();
}
//--------------------------------------------------------------------------------------------------
function process_receive_po()
{
- global $path_to_root;
+ global $path_to_root, $Ajax;
if (!can_process())
return;
unset($_SESSION['PO']->line_items);
unset($_SESSION['PO']);
unset($_POST['ProcessGoodsReceived']);
+ $Ajax->activate('_page_body');
exit;
}
$_POST[$line->line_no] = max($_POST[$line->line_no], 0);
if (!check_num($line->line_no))
- $_POST[$line->line_no] = qty_format(0, $line->stock_id);
+ $_POST[$line->line_no] = number_format2(0, get_qty_dec($line->stock_id));
if (!isset($_POST['DefaultReceivedDate']) || $_POST['DefaultReceivedDate'] == "")
$_POST['DefaultReceivedDate'] = Today();
$_SESSION['PO']->line_items[$line->line_no]->item_description = $_POST[$line->stock_id . "Desc"];
}
}
+ $Ajax->activate('grn_items');
}
//--------------------------------------------------------------------------------------------------
display_heading(_("Items to Receive"));
display_po_receive_items();
-echo "<br><center>";
-submit('Update', _("Update"));
-echo " ";
-submit('ProcessGoodsReceived', _("Process Receive Items"));
-echo "</center>";
+echo '<br>';
+submit_center_first('Update', _("Update"), '', true);
+submit_center_last('ProcessGoodsReceived', _("Process Receive Items"), _("Clear all GL entry fields"), true);
end_form();